Account recovery — Verifex plugin host. If the plugin registry account locks, do not reset via the admin UI; it wipes validator plugin signatures. Instead: stop the host, run verifex-admin unlock --offline, then re-sync the plugin manifest from the mirror. Validators failing checksum afterward must be re-signed by the release key holder. Check loaded plugins with verifex-admin list; anything unsigned gets quarantined automatically. The offline unlock step prompts once, and it accepts only the recovery passphrase given below.

strongbox words: zorath-holmir

Runbook — Account Recovery, SheetFerry CSV Import Wizard

If the import wizard's service account locks mid-release, halt pending imports first. Do not retry uploads; partial batches will duplicate rows. Unlock via the recovery console on the admin node, then resume the queue. The console prompts once for the recovery passphrase, recorded below.

vault phrase of yadug-bawep = wenix-sorael-norwyn-belwyn-istix-ulaath-briael-eliok-fenir-silok-frair-casix-holox-praax

### Meeting notes — Remindry scheduler review, 14 March

We walked through the Remindry job that sends appointment reminders for the Willowgate clinic group. Confirmed the job runs at 06:00 local, skips patients flagged opt-out, and retries failed sends twice with backoff. Agreed the timezone handling for the Northbay satellite clinic needs a regression test before the next release. Action items were logged in the tracker. Future escalations and schema changes should go through the owner named below.

approver of yajef-fajef = Oliwyn Silion Kasok Kasox